Steinbach names new Library after former my by Paul Pleura for the free press Steinbach a Jake Epp was welcomed Home yesterday by the Community that once shunned him for his politics. Epp the conservative my for Provencher for 21 years was honoured at the grand opening of the towns $1.2-million Library that bears his name. A it feels Good to be Back Home a said Epp. As a Cabinet minister under Joe Clark Brian Mulroney Epp faced the Challenge of every Mph toe the party line versus Bend to the Call of local constituents. This was evident in 1989 when Epp supported a government Bill that liberalized abortion even though it was Clear a majority of his constituents did not. Epp said criticism conflict Tough choices Are part parcel of the democratic process the Price of holding Public office. Epp was a teacher a town coun Epp Lef Steinbach mayor Les Magnusson at ribbon cutting. Below new Library. Ocillor in Steinbach before running federally for the progressive conservatives in 1972. He left politics in 1993, is now the senior vice president of Tran Canada pipelines Ltd. In Calgary president of Tran Canada International business developers. R3c 3z5 attention David Golub Tiffany file no. 47665 phone no. 204 957-0520 Brick tossing ends in stabbing Aman accused of tossing a Brick through a car window is now recovering in Hospital from a serious Stab wound to his Abdomen. A 35-year-old Man threw a Brick through a car window on landside Street at 2 Yesterday was greeted by an angry car owner Winnipeg police said. As the two men began to fight the car owner pulled a knife stabbed the Brick thrower. Andrew Shakespeare 26, of Broadway is charged with aggravated assault possessing a dangerous weapon. The Brick thrower required emergency surgery at health sciences Centre. He was listed in stable condition yesterday afternoon May also face charges. If the Law is a bother just change i it Paul Wiecek by does it seem sometimes that government expects everyone to live according to the letter of the Law except themselves take the Case of Dave Lindsay. In his bid to have a 1995 conviction for refusing a breathalyser overturned Lindsay discovered an obscure Section of something called the Law fees act that allows the poor to have their court fees a transcripts filing Etc. A waived if they Are declared paupers. That a the Way its supposed to work anyway. The Law has its roots in England was enacted Here decades ago to ensure the poor had Access to the courts. But when Manitoba introduced Legal in 1972, everyone forgot about the pauper Law. It has been collecting dust in the legislature Library Ever since. But Lindsay dusted it off recently As part of his efforts to Appeal his own conviction. And that a made the provincial government very uncomfortable. Lindsay maintains he never refused the breathalyser but simply asked police to allow him to speak to his lawyer prior to taking the test. After he did so was instructed to take it Lindsay says he asked a then demanded a to take the breathalyser. But he says he was told by police that head had his Chance it was too late. Which sounds like a reasonable basis for an Appeal in this Corner one which at least deserves a hearing in court. But in order for Lindsay to Appeal the conviction he needs a transcript of his trial the province wont give him one until he pays $415.80. Lindsay who makes just $6 an hour working in a warehouse has paid the first $150 but does no to have the rest. And Legal Manitoba has refused to cover his Appeal costs because of a policy that stipulates Only cases involving the possibility of jail time or Job loss Are covered. Lindsay is willing to represent himself in the Appeal but he believes he a entitled to have the Cost of the transcript a other administrative costs a covered under the terms of the pauper Law however old that Law might be. A a it a still the Law of the land a Lindsay said last week. The province however has refused. Assistant Deputy Justice minister Alan Fineblit explained the Law society previously issued pauper certificates but stopped doing so years ago when such requests dried up. And with no Agency issuing certificates any More Lindsay is out of Luck. A you can to pay for court fees with something that does no to exist anymore a Fineblit explained. But Lindsay believes the province has other reasons for refusing to give him a paupers certificate. A it would set a precedent that could end up costing the government Money a he said. A that a the last thing they want to do because with All the Legal cutbacks application fees now there a a lot of people who could take advantage of a Section like Lindsay makes a Point. Earlier this year the province trimmed $200,000 from the Legal budget handed Down an edict that will ultimately result in Legal taking on fewer civil cases. Last year a $25 non refundable application fee was also introduced. And if you re still not convinced the government takes All this very seriously consider this earlier this month the tories introduced a Bill in the legislature that formally repeals the pauper Section of the Law fees act. A Justice official said its just a housekeeping piece of legislation to wipe off the books a Law that a should have been repealed years funny that the province wont pay out under the Law yet feels its legitimate enough to formally repeal.
